When converting DC to AC, it is conceivable to gain the preferred output voltage and frequency by two types of inverters, one of it is two level and another one is multi-level inverter (MLI). The multilevel inverter are used in many applications which include motor drives, power conditioning devices, renewable energy generation and distribution. PWM inverters are used to can output voltage simultaneously and it can lower the amount of harmonics in output current that results in better THD content. In multilevel inverter Cascaded H-Bridge inverter is more efficient when compared to the other types of Multi- level inverter. Some of the advantages of MLI are Minimum total harmonic distortion, reduced EMI and it could be operated on different voltage levels. In this project MOSFETs are used as switches, here Simulation of single phase 5- level cascaded Multi-level inverter with separate DC sources is done. By choosing the microcontroller design implemented a 5-level pulse-width modulation technique for greater efficiency. Standard high voltage components was chosen for the MOSFET drivers. There has been Several multilevel topologies developed, but when the output voltage levels increases, it also increases the number of switches, number of independent dc sources, switching stresses, losses, voltage unbalancing across capacitors etc.
